
解决Excel文件过大的方法有:优化数据存储、压缩图片、移除不必要的格式、减少使用的公式、利用数据透视表。 在这些方法中,优化数据存储是最常见且有效的方式。通过删除不必要的数据、使用更高效的数据存储格式,可以显著减少Excel文件的大小。下面将详细介绍如何通过这些方法来优化和减小Excel文件的大小。
一、优化数据存储
删除不必要的数据
Excel文件的大小通常与文件中存储的数据量直接相关。删除不必要的数据可以显著减少文件的大小。可以通过以下步骤来删除不必要的数据:
-
删除空行和空列:有时工作表中会包含大量的空行和空列,这些空行和空列也会占用文件空间。删除这些空行和空列可以减小文件大小。可以使用“Ctrl + Shift + End”选择工作表的末尾单元格,然后删除多余的行和列。
-
删除重复数据:工作表中可能会包含大量重复数据,删除这些重复数据不仅可以减小文件大小,还可以提高数据的管理和分析效率。可以使用Excel的“删除重复项”功能来删除重复数据。
-
清理无用数据:有时工作表中可能会包含一些临时数据或中间计算结果,这些数据在最终文件中并不需要保存。清理这些无用数据可以显著减小文件大小。
使用更高效的数据存储格式
Excel支持多种数据存储格式,选择合适的数据存储格式可以有效减少文件大小。例如:
-
文本格式:对于包含大量文本数据的工作表,可以将文本数据存储为纯文本格式(例如.csv文件)。纯文本格式比Excel格式(.xlsx文件)占用的空间更小。
-
压缩格式:Excel文件本身支持压缩格式(.xlsx文件),与旧版的Excel格式(.xls文件)相比,.xlsx文件可以显著减少文件大小。如果文件仍然较大,可以考虑使用压缩工具(例如ZIP)进一步压缩文件。
二、压缩图片
图片是Excel文件中占用空间较大的部分之一。通过压缩图片可以显著减小文件大小。可以通过以下步骤来压缩图片:
-
使用Excel内置的图片压缩功能:选择要压缩的图片,点击“图片工具”选项卡中的“压缩图片”按钮,可以选择压缩图片的分辨率和删除未使用的图片部分。
-
使用外部工具压缩图片:在插入图片之前,可以使用外部图片压缩工具(例如TinyPNG、JPEGmini)将图片压缩到合适的大小,然后再插入到Excel文件中。
-
减少图片数量:尽量减少工作表中图片的数量,特别是高分辨率和大尺寸的图片。可以通过合并图片或使用矢量图形(例如SVG格式)来减少文件大小。
三、移除不必要的格式
Excel文件中的格式设置(例如字体、颜色、边框、条件格式等)也会占用文件空间。移除不必要的格式可以显著减小文件大小。可以通过以下步骤来移除不必要的格式:
-
清除格式:选择需要清除格式的单元格或区域,右键点击选择“清除格式”选项,可以清除选定单元格的所有格式设置。
-
减少条件格式:条件格式是Excel中常用的格式设置功能,但过多的条件格式会增加文件大小。可以通过合并条件格式或删除不必要的条件格式来减小文件大小。
-
使用样式:使用Excel的样式功能可以简化格式设置,减少格式的重复定义,从而减小文件大小。可以定义和应用统一的样式,而不是对每个单元格单独设置格式。
四、减少使用的公式
Excel文件中的公式也会占用空间,特别是复杂的公式和大量的数组公式。减少使用的公式可以显著减小文件大小。可以通过以下方法来减少使用的公式:
-
使用值代替公式:对于计算结果不需要动态更新的公式,可以将公式计算结果复制并粘贴为值。这样可以减少公式的数量,从而减小文件大小。
-
简化公式:尽量简化公式,减少公式中的嵌套层次和计算步骤。例如,可以使用辅助列存储中间计算结果,然后在最终公式中引用这些辅助列。
-
减少数组公式:数组公式通常需要占用更多的内存和计算资源,尽量减少数组公式的使用。可以通过分解数组公式为多个普通公式来减小文件大小。
五、利用数据透视表
数据透视表是Excel中强大的数据分析工具,可以帮助组织和汇总大量数据。利用数据透视表可以减少数据的存储量,从而减小文件大小。可以通过以下步骤来利用数据透视表:
-
创建数据透视表:选择数据源,点击“插入”选项卡中的“数据透视表”按钮,按照向导步骤创建数据透视表。
-
汇总数据:使用数据透视表的汇总功能,可以将大量数据汇总为较小的数据集,从而减少数据的存储量。例如,可以汇总销售数据、库存数据等。
-
删除原始数据:在创建数据透视表并汇总数据之后,可以删除原始数据,从而减小文件大小。需要注意的是,删除原始数据之前应确保数据透视表中已经包含了所有需要的汇总数据。
六、其他优化技巧
除了以上方法,还有一些其他的优化技巧可以帮助减小Excel文件的大小:
-
禁用宏和VBA代码:如果Excel文件中包含宏和VBA代码,可以禁用不必要的宏和VBA代码,从而减小文件大小。可以通过“开发工具”选项卡中的“宏”按钮管理和禁用宏。
-
使用引用而不是复制数据:在多个工作表之间共享数据时,可以使用引用而不是复制数据。这样可以减少数据的重复存储,从而减小文件大小。
-
定期清理和优化文件:定期检查和清理Excel文件,删除不必要的数据、格式和公式,可以保持文件的高效和小巧。
通过以上方法,可以有效地优化和减小Excel文件的大小,提高文件的管理和使用效率。希望这些方法能够帮助您解决Excel文件过大的问题。
相关问答FAQs:
1. 如何设置Excel文件的大小限制?
- 问题:我想知道如何设置Excel文件的大小限制,因为我的文件太大了,导致运行缓慢。
- 回答:要设置Excel文件的大小限制,可以通过以下步骤进行操作:
- 第一步:打开Excel文件,选择“文件”选项卡。
- 第二步:在“文件”选项卡下,选择“选项”。
- 第三步:在“Excel选项”对话框中,选择“高级”选项。
- 第四步:在“高级”选项下,找到“工作簿大小和缓存”部分。
- 第五步:在“工作簿大小和缓存”部分,可以设置“最大工作表行数”和“最大工作表列数”来限制文件大小。
- 第六步:根据需要,设置适当的数值后,点击“确定”保存设置。
2. 如何压缩Excel文件的大小?
- 问题:我需要将Excel文件的大小压缩,以便更方便地分享或存储。有什么方法可以做到这一点?
- 回答:要压缩Excel文件的大小,可以尝试以下方法:
- 方法一:删除不必要的数据或空白行列。
- 方法二:缩小图表、图片和对象的尺寸。
- 方法三:使用Excel的“文件另存为”功能,将文件保存为较新版本的格式,如.xlsx代替.xls。
- 方法四:压缩文件中的图像,可以使用图片编辑工具或在线压缩工具。
- 方法五:使用压缩软件,如WinRAR或7-Zip,将文件打包为ZIP格式。
3. 如何优化Excel文件的性能以应对大文件大小?
- 问题:我的Excel文件很大,运行时变得非常缓慢。有没有什么方法可以优化文件的性能?
- 回答:要优化Excel文件的性能以应对大文件大小,可以考虑以下方法:
- 方法一:删除不需要的格式,如冗余的单元格格式、条件格式等。
- 方法二:使用公式和函数时,避免使用过于复杂或计算量大的公式。
- 方法三:将数据分割成多个工作表或工作簿,以减少单个文件的大小。
- 方法四:禁用自动计算功能,在需要计算时手动触发计算。
- 方法五:关闭不需要的插件或附加组件,以减少程序的负担。
- 方法六:定期清理临时文件和缓存,以释放系统资源。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4958521